How to hang Linkydoodles on your tree.

For best results, assemble and hang one swag at a time. To make a garland, start with the heart. Hang two S hooks on either side. Attach one end to the tree. If you have an artificial tree it helps to hook the end of the branch slightly to secure the swag. Then attach the opposite end. If you are decorating a live tree, the tips of your branches may be too flexible to hold the weight of the swag. In that case, and ordinary twist tie or piece of string can be used to secure the CandyChain.

How Are Linkydoodles Made?

Linkydoodles™ CandyChains™ are real candy; made from an old-fashioned candy cane recipe that is cooked in small batches in a traditional copper kettle. Each “doodle” is shaped by hand, one-at-a-time, then dipped in confectioner's glaze. This helps keep out moisture and keep in flavor. Unlike cane-shaped candy, Linkydoodles can be linked together to form a swag or CandyChain.
